web-dev-qa-db-ja.com

ラップトップでディスクリートGPUを使用するように強制するにはどうすればよいですか?

私のラップトップ(Asus X7BSV)は、統合されたGPUのみを使用してスタックしています。 nVidia GT540Mも搭載していますが、動作しません。

最新のドライバーがインストールされたWindows 7 x64を使用しています。

これは、作業に必要な外部USBモニターを接続した後に発生し、それ以降はnVidia GPUにスワップバックできません(たとえば、dxdiagは、プライマリGPUがIntel統合GPUであると述べています)。

Asusのサポートからシステムを完全に再インストールするように求められましたが、それは私がしたくないことです。 BIOSを確認しましたが、使用するGPUに関するオプションはありません。 nVidiaカード自体は動作しています。CUDAを使用できるため、Ubuntu Live CDで動作しました。 nVidiaソフトウェア管理では、グローバル設定の高性能GPU(nVidia)に設定してみましたが、影響はありませんでした。

ここで何が欠けていますか?外付けモニターに関連するすべてのドライバーとソフトウェアをアンインストール/削除しましたが、それは役に立ちませんでした。

8
SinisterMJ

Latitude E6520にIntel HD Graphics 3000、NVIDIA NVS 4200M、およびWindows 7 Enterpriseを搭載しているため、NVIDIAコントロールパネルを使用して、特定のプロセッサをアプリケーションごとまたはグローバルに強制できます。次のいずれかを試してください。

  • デスクトップを右クリックして、NVIDIAコントロールパネルを選択します。
  • コントロールパネルに移動してNVIDIAコントロールパネルを検索する

インストールしていない場合は、最新のNVIDIAドライバーを使用していることを確認してください。

enter image description here

NVIDIAコントロールパネルの下で、D設定-> 3D設定の管理に移動します。 グローバル設定タブを選択し、優先グラフィックプロセッサドロップダウンを使用して高性能NVIDIAプロセッサを選択します。次に適用ボタンを押します。コンピュータを再起動する必要がある場合があります。

8
Terrance